AMIDiag Suite for DOS and Windows

AMIDiag Suite is a complete hardware diagnostics package, which I had a lot of fun testing. I have always loved dinking with utilities and diagnostics programs. That is where I fed my fascination and also learned the most in the early days of DOS and Windows 3.1. AMIDiag Suite includes both AMIDiag 6.11 for DOS as well as the brand new AMIDiag for Windows. No such software will ever be 100% perfect, but this is  probably the most reliable available today.

The Package

Installation CD
Contains all installation files, including a documentation PDF file for each version. Yes, it would be nice to have printed documentation in front of you, but don't forget about the F1 help key, which will give you pretty decent info as you need it.

AMIDiag Suite Quick Start Guide
Easy to follow installation instructions and an overview of the program features.

Serial and Parallel External Loop-back Plugs
An effective way to verify that a PC's serial and parallel ports are working correctly. With the plugs, an input/output "loop" is created, allowing the program to send data out of the PC, then receive data back. Most all other diagnostic software packages do not include these, yet will say how very important it is that you use them!

Error Code Guide
A spiral bound book with all of the errors known to the program that you may encounter. The tables include the error code, an explanation and the recommended action. Very handy to have, especially if you ran a batch mode.


Platform

Compatible with Windows 95/98/ME/NT/2000. Now, I'm not experienced with Windows ME, but according to AMI, AMIDiag is the only diagnostic software that runs in DOS mode and is capable of running on a Windows ME system without the need for a DOS floppy.
